大家好,我是一名长期使用海外VPS的用户。在各种业务场景下,我尝试过许多不同的平台和配置,也积累了一些经验。今天,我想和大家分享一下关于IPv4和IPv6的知识,以及在不同情况下该如何选择。
一、IPv4与IPv6的基础知识
1.1 什么是IPv4?
IPv4,即互联网协议第四版,是目前广泛使用的网络协议。它采用32位地址格式,理论上能提供约43亿个唯一的IP地址。随着互联网的迅猛发展,IPv4地址资源逐渐枯竭,就像城市里的车位越来越难找。
1.2 什么是IPv6?
为了解决IPv4地址耗尽的问题,IPv6(互联网协议第六版)应运而生。它采用128位地址格式,地址数量达到2的128次方,这个数字有多大呢?大到可以给地球上的每一粒沙子都分配数百万个IP地址。
二、IPv4和IPv6的主要区别
– 地址容量:IPv4约有43亿个地址,IPv6则有3.4×10的38次方个地址。
– 地址表示:
IPv4:点分十进制表示,例如192.168.0.1。
IPv6:冒号分隔的十六进制表示,例如2001:0db8:85a3:0000:0000:8a2e:0370:7334。
– 网络配置:IPv6支持自动配置,更加方便设备接入网络。
– 安全性:IPv6内置了IPSec协议,增强了数据传输的安全性。
三、不同业务场景下的选择
3.1 网站托管
如果您的目标用户主要使用IPv4网络,那么选择支持IPv4的VPS是必要的。目前,大部分用户仍然依赖IPv4,因此确保网站在IPv4网络下可访问至关重要。不过,支持IPv6可以提高未来兼容性,毕竟科技的发展总是超乎想象。
3.2 大规模设备连接
对于需要大量IP地址的项目,例如物联网设备连接、数据采集等,IPv6是理想的选择。它庞大的地址空间可以满足几乎无限的连接需求,避免了IPv4地址不够用的尴尬。
3.3 地区访问限制
有些地区或网络环境对IPv4或IPv6有特定的支持或限制。在这种情况下,需要根据目标地区的网络状况选择合适的IP版本。
四、测试VPS的网络质量
在购买VPS之前,进行一些测试可以帮助我们更好地了解其性能。
4.1 Ping延迟测试
使用“ping”命令测试VPS的网络延迟,数值越低,网络响应速度越快。
ping -c 4 your_vps_ip
4.2 带宽测试
利用“iperf”等工具测试网络带宽,确保满足业务的传输需求。
4.3 IP归属地查询
通过在线工具查询VPS的IP归属地,确认其位于预期的地理位置。
– 示例工具:IPIP.net
五、购买VPS时需要注意的问题
1. IP类型支持:确认VPS是否提供IPv4、IPv6或双栈支持,确保符合业务需求。
2. 网络质量:查看VPS提供商的网络状况,是否有丢包、延迟高等问题。
3. 售后服务:选择提供及时技术支持的供应商,方便遇到问题时迅速解决。
4. 价格透明度:注意是否有隐藏费用,例如IP地址的额外收费等。
5. 资源配置:根据业务需要选择合适的CPU、内存和存储配置,避免资源浪费或不足。
六、新手需要避免的坑
– 只关注价格,不看性能:过于追求低价,可能会导致选择的VPS性能不足,影响业务运行。
– 忽略IP支持类型:未确认VPS支持的IP版本,导致后续需要重新更换服务商。
– 不进行测试:购买前未对VPS进行基本的性能和网络测试,后续可能出现不可预见的问题。
– 忽视合同条款:未仔细阅读服务协议,可能在退款、赔偿等方面遇到麻烦。
结语
选择IPv4还是IPv6,关键在于您的业务需求和目标用户群体。对于需要广泛兼容性的业务,建议选择同时支持IPv4和IPv6的VPS。希望我的分享能为大家在选择VPS时提供一些有用的参考。
在信息技术飞速发展的今天,多了解一些相关知识,总不会是坏事。祝大家都能找到最适合自己的VPS方案,少踩坑,多省心。